Our office is dedicated to helping patients who struggle with sleep apnea and CPAP intolerance find effective, comfortable alternatives through oral appliance therapy. We combine modern dental technology with a collaborative, well-organized work environment.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Assist the doctor chairside during consultations and appliance fittings. 
  • Take impressions and support oral appliance therapy procedures. 
  • Capture radiographs and digital/3D scans as needed. 
  • Prepare and maintain treatment rooms, including instrument sterilization. 
  • Keep accurate and organized patient records. 
  • Provide clear, supportive patient education on treatment and appliance care.
